Keeping track of all of your expenses is important towards developing a solid plan for the future. If you just write this information in a place you do not look at frequently, it may not have a great effect on your behavior. Try using a whiteboard in your den or home office to document your finances. It will be front and center during your daily activities and hard to avoid.

Stop charging the credit cards you cannot afford. Downsize your spending habits and find alternate ways of paying your bills to stay away from your credit limit. Pay down your balance completely before you consider using the card in the future.

Make saving money your first priority each time you are paid. It is easier to save money every week rather than waiting to see what you have left when the month is over. Setting this money aside right away, makes it out of sight and out of mind. It becomes easier to see what remaining amount you have to spend, therefore, you will be less likely to be tempted to use it on a whim. You will also not be giving yourself a chance to forget to set some money aside.

Eat as though you are a local when traveling to other countries and you will save money. Ask where locals go when they want a bite to eat; in tourist areas and hotels, restaurants tend to be overpriced. You will enjoy better prices and a much more authentic dining experience.

Make sure you use a flexible spending account. Flexible spending accounts can really save you cash, especially if you have ongoing medical costs or a consistent daycare bill. You can set aside established amounts of money before taxes so that you will be able to manage this sort of expense. There are certain conditions to these accounts, and you will have to talk with a tax professional.
